## Env Vars — Admin Table Bulk Edits (Quillbarn Console)

Bulk edits are gated by BULK_EDIT_ENABLED and capped by BULK_EDIT_MAX_ROWS (default 500). Each batch writes an audit record before commit; rollback is automatic on partial failure. Releases must verify both flags match the change ticket. The audit service authenticates with a token whose secret is set on the following line.

vault entry, yahif-yajep: COURIER_KEY29=b802bdf8034096b65a51c6ba5abe2

## Deploying the Gatewick Proctor Queue

Deploys are pretty painless: push to main, wait for the pipeline, then watch the queue drain dashboard for five minutes. If candidates pile up mid-exam, roll back first and ask questions later — the queue replays safely. Everything the workers care about lives in one config block, shown here for reference.

settings of bafof-yagef:
JOROX_PIN=8740
JOROX_TENANT=pelox
JOROX_METRICS_HOST=metrics.jorox.qorvelworks.internal
JOROX_SEAL=seal_c78f63c1
JOROX_STANDBY_TEAM=norax

**Mgmt Meeting Minutes — Retiring the Brightline Range**

Quick recap for sales leads at Fenholt Supplies: we agreed to retire the Brightline fixture range by year-end. Remaining stock moves to clearance pricing next month, and accounts on standing orders get migrated to the Lumetta range. Trade-in incentives were approved in principle. The confidential note on next steps sits just below.

board note of bajof-bajeg: The pricing group signed off on a budget of $13.4 million for Project Sildor. The renewal with Lamixek Holdings closes at $48.9 million a year, 49 percent above the last contract.